What is Average Selling Price (ASP)?

Average Selling Price (ASP) is a crucial metric in the world of business. It represents the average price at which your products or services are sold. Monitoring ASP provides valuable insights into your sales performance, allowing you to make informed decisions to boost revenue.

Understanding your ASP enables you to identify trends, adjust pricing strategies, and fine-tune your sales approaches. By analyzing ASP, you can optimize your pricing to maximize profitability and foster business growth.

Importance of Monitoring ASP

Monitoring ASP is crucial for your business for several reasons:

  • Tracking Trends: By monitoring fluctuations in your ASP, you can identify trends in product demand and adjust your inventory or marketing strategies accordingly.
  • Pricing Strategy Optimization: Understanding your ASP helps you optimize your pricing strategy to maximize profitability. You can adjust prices based on market demand and competition to attract more customers.
  • Sales Performance Evaluation: Monitoring ASP provides insights into your sales performance. You can assess the effectiveness of your sales team and strategies and make data-driven decisions to improve performance.
  • Revenue Growth: By keeping a close eye on your ASP, you can make informed decisions that lead to increased revenue. Adjusting prices, offering discounts, or bundling products based on ASP data can drive growth.
  • Competitive Advantage: Monitoring ASP allows you to stay competitive in the market. By analyzing your pricing compared to competitors and industry benchmarks, you can position your products effectively.

Remember, staying proactive in monitoring your ASP can lead to improved decision-making and long-term success for your business.

Analyzing ASP Trends

When Analyzing ASP Trends, you gain valuable insights into pricing dynamics and customer behavior. By tracking changes in ASP over time, you can identify patterns, such as seasonal fluctuations or the impact of marketing campaigns. This analysis enables you to adjust your pricing strategy in real-time, maximizing revenue and profit margins.

Some key points to consider when Analyzing ASP Trends include:

  • Look for correlations between ASP and sales volume.
  • Monitor how competitors’ pricing affects your ASP.
  • Use data visualization tools to spot trends quickly.
  • Segment your products to analyze ASP at a granular level.

With a comprehensive approach to Analyzing ASP Trends, you can make data-driven decisions that enhance your bottom line and keep your business competitive.

Adjusting Pricing Strategies

When it comes to Adjusting Pricing Strategies based on Average Selling Price (ASP) trends, it’s crucial to stay agile and responsive to market changes. Here are some key points to consider:

  • Dynamic Pricing: Implement real-time pricing adjustments to capitalize on demand fluctuations and maximize revenue.
  • Promotional Strategies: Use ASP insights to design targeted promotional campaigns that drive sales without compromising profitability.
  • Competitive Analysis: Monitor competitors’ pricing strategies and adjust your prices accordingly to maintain a competitive edge.
  • Product Bundling: Bundle high and low ASP products strategically to increase overall revenue and promote cross-selling.
  • Seasonal Adjustments: Adapt pricing strategies during peak seasons or lulls based on ASP trends and customer buying behaviors.

Staying proactive in Adjusting Pricing Strategies based on ASP data can enhance your business’s bottom line and market position.
